Database Schema

AnimeSeries

  • Primary Key: id (auto-increment)
  • Unique Key: key (provider identifier)
  • Fields: name, site, folder, description, status, total_episodes, cover_url, episode_dict
  • Relationships: One-to-many with Episode and DownloadQueueItem
  • Indexes: key, name
  • Cascade: Delete episodes and download items on series deletion

Episode

  • Primary Key: id
  • Foreign Key: series_id → AnimeSeries
  • Fields: season, episode_number, title, file_path, file_size, is_downloaded, download_date
  • Relationship: Many-to-one with AnimeSeries
  • Indexes: series_id

DownloadQueueItem

  • Primary Key: id
  • Foreign Key: series_id → AnimeSeries
  • Fields: season, episode_number, status (enum), priority (enum), progress_percent, downloaded_bytes, total_bytes, download_speed, error_message, retry_count, download_url, file_destination, started_at, completed_at
  • Status Enum: PENDING, DOWNLOADING, PAUSED, COMPLETED, FAILED, CANCELLED
  • Priority Enum: LOW, NORMAL, HIGH
  • Indexes: series_id, status
  • Relationship: Many-to-one with AnimeSeries

UserSession

  • Primary Key: id
  • Unique Key: session_id
  • Fields: token_hash, user_id, ip_address, user_agent, expires_at, is_active, last_activity
  • Methods: is_expired (property), revoke()
  • Indexes: session_id, user_id, is_active

Technical Highlights

Python Version Compatibility

  • Issue: SQLAlchemy 2.0.23 incompatible with Python 3.13
  • Solution: Upgraded to SQLAlchemy 2.0.44
  • Result: All tests passing on Python 3.13.7

Async Support

  • Uses aiosqlite for async SQLite operations
  • AsyncSession for non-blocking database operations
  • Proper async context managers for session lifecycle

SQLite Optimizations

  • WAL (Write-Ahead Logging) mode enabled
  • Foreign key constraints enabled via PRAGMA
  • Static pool for single-connection use
  • Automatic conversion of sqlite:/// to sqlite+aiosqlite:///

Type Safety

  • Comprehensive type hints using SQLAlchemy 2.0 Mapped types
  • Pydantic integration for validation
  • Type-safe relationships and foreign keys

Notes

  • SQLite is used for development and single-instance deployments
  • PostgreSQL/MySQL recommended for multi-process production deployments
  • Connection pooling configured for both development and production scenarios
  • All foreign key relationships properly enforced
  • Cascade deletes configured for data consistency
  • Indexes added for frequently queried columns
